Takayasu's arteritis (TA) is an idiopathic great vessel vasculitis that affects the aorta and its branches. This entity is associated with the major histocompatibility complex (MHC) genes. We studied DNA sequences of human leu-kocyte antigens (HLA) haplotypes in one pair of Mexican monozygotic twins affected by TA. HLA alleles were deter-mined by sequence-specific priming. Genetic testing of the HLA haplotypes in both sisters were A*02 B*39 DRB1*04 DQB1*03 :02/A*24 B*35 DRB1*16 DQB1*03:01. These results confirm that within the MHC are genes that de-termine genetic susceptibility to develop TA and sustain genetic heterogeneity of this disease among populations.
